Humaira

 

Gender: Female
Origin: Arabic
Meaning: Of Red Colour

What is the meaning of the name Humaira?

The name Humaira is primarily a female name of Arabic origin that means Of Red Colour.

The name “Humaira” is of Arabic origin. It is derived from the Arabic word “ḥumayra” (حُمَيْرَاء), which is the feminine form of “ḥumayr” (حُمَيْر), meaning “reddish” or “rosy-cheeked.” Therefore, the meaning of the name “Humaira” can be interpreted as “reddish” or “rosy-cheeked.”

Different Spellings of the name Humaira:

Variations in the spelling of the name “Humaira” may arise due to transliteration differences, regional accents, or personal preferences. Here are a few possible alternative spellings:

1. Humeira
2. Homyra
3. Humyra
4. Humeyra
5. Humayra

These variations might not be as widely used or recognized as the standard spelling “Humaira,” but they demonstrate how the name might be adapted or interpreted differently by different individuals or in different contexts.
